In this episode of Policy Unpacked, a podcast by the Global Policy Network (GPN), host Stephen Riley is joined by Uzo Ibechukwu, Chief Pharmacist at Royal United Hospitals Bath and former ICS Chief Pharmacist for Bath, Swindon and Wiltshire, to explore what the NHS 10-Year Plan means for hospital pharmacy.
